Importance of Camera Selection in Real Estate Photography

The effectiveness of property listings heavily relies on the quality of images captured, making camera selection a pivotal factor. A high-quality camera can vividly showcase the best features of a property, drawing in prospective buyers. Additionally, lens selection plays a vital role in capturing intricate details, as different lenses can dramatically alter the perspective and composition of property images. Key features to consider when choosing a camera for real estate photography include:
- High-resolution sensor for clear, detailed images
- Wide dynamic range to capture both highlights and shadows
- Interchangeable lenses for versatility in shots
- Stabilization features to avoid blur in low-light conditions
Recommended Cameras for Real Estate Photography
When it comes to selecting the perfect camera for real estate photography, a few models stand out. Here’s a list of top-rated cameras renowned for their performance in capturing stunning property images:
- Canon EOS R5
- Resolution: 45 MP
- Sensor: Full-frame CMOS
- Video Capability: 8K recording
- Features: Dual Pixel autofocus, in-body image stabilization
- Nikon Z6 II
- Resolution: 24.5 MP
- Sensor: Full-frame BSI CMOS
- Video Capability: 4K recording
- Features: Dual card slots, enhanced autofocus
- Fujifilm X-T4
- Resolution: 26.1 MP
- Sensor: APS-C X-Trans CMOS 4
- Video Capability: 4K recording
- Features: In-body image stabilization, film simulation modes
Both mirrorless and DSLR cameras have their advantages for real estate photography. Mirrorless cameras tend to be more compact and offer faster shooting speeds, while DSLRs provide a more traditional feel with a robust selection of lenses.

Essential Photography Gear for Real Estate
To optimize real estate photography, certain accessories are indispensable. Having the right gear can elevate the quality of your images significantly. Essential items include:
- Tripod: Ensures stability for long exposure shots, particularly in low-light conditions.
- Wide-angle lens: crucial for capturing spacious interiors and making rooms appear larger.
- External lighting: softboxes or flash units help illuminate dark areas and highlight property features.
- Filters: polarizing filters can reduce glare and enhance the color saturation of the sky and foliage.

Enhancing property images requires a keen understanding of composition and lighting. Effective techniques include:
- Utilizing the rule of thirds to create balanced compositions.
- Employing natural light by shooting during golden hour to achieve soft, flattering illumination.
- Staging rooms with minimal distractions and ensuring they are clean and organized.
A helpful checklist for shooting different areas of a property includes:
- Living Room: Capture from corners to emphasize space.
- Kitchen: Focus on unique features like islands or appliances.
- Bedrooms: Highlight natural light and space with open doors or windows.
Post-Processing Tips for Real Estate Photos
Editing plays a crucial role in real estate photography, enhancing images while maintaining realism. Common techniques include:
- Adjusting brightness and contrast to highlight property features.
- Correcting lens distortions often seen with wide-angle lenses.
- Applying sharpening to ensure details pop without creating noise.
Popular software options for editing include Adobe Lightroom and Photoshop, which provide extensive tools for enhancing property photos. A step-by-step guide for enhancing images involves:
- Importing images into the software
- Adjusting exposure and contrast
- Correcting color balance
- Applying sharpening and noise reduction
- Exporting images in the appropriate format for listings

Real Estate Photography Pricing Strategies
Understanding the factors influencing pricing for real estate photography services is essential. Key considerations include:
- Complexity of the shoot, including location and property size.
- Time required for post-processing and editing.
- The photographer’s experience and equipment level.
Creating a pricing structure based on different service levels offered is beneficial. For example:
- Basic Package: $150 – Includes up to 20 edited images
- Standard Package: $300 – Includes up to 40 edited images and a virtual tour
- Premium Package: $500 – Includes full property coverage, drone shots, and advanced editing
Justifying pricing to potential clients can be achieved by highlighting the value of professional photography in enhancing property appeal and speeding up the sale process.
